Barry-Lawrence Regional Cooperative Libraries was initially established on July 13th, 1954 when the library boards of Barry and Lawrence Counties jointly agreed to join in providing library service to the counties. A variety of programs, including story hours, home school enrichment, summer reading promotions, book talks, exhibits, movies, and other cultural events will be provided for all ages. It is the aim of the Barry-Lawrence Regional Library to provide public access computers for word processing, Internet access, e-mail, and educational software.
